Tips for job seekers moving to HAREFIELD


Located in the London commuter belt, Harefield is a small village in the UK that offers a charming and peaceful environment for those looking to move for work. With easy access to central London via train, Harefield provides the perfect balance between rural living and urban convenience. The village itself has a rich history dating back to the 14th century and boasts beautiful architecture, including the stunning St. Mary's Church.

One of the main reasons people choose to move to Harefield is for the excellent job opportunities in the nearby city of Uxbridge. Home to many major companies, including HM Revenue & Customs, Barclays, and Tesco, Uxbridge offers a diverse range of industries and sectors to work in. Additionally, Harefield is close to Heathrow Airport, making it an ideal location for those working in the aviation industry.

For those who enjoy outdoor activities, Harefield has plenty to offer. The village is surrounded by beautiful countryside and is home to several parks and green spaces, including Hillingdon Park and Ruislip Woods. The nearby Grand Union Canal also offers opportunities for boating, fishing, and walking.

When it comes to education, Harefield has a range of schools to choose from, including Harefield Primary School and Uxbridge High School. These schools offer high-quality education and have good reputations in the local area.

In terms of housing, Harefield offers a mix of old and new properties, ranging from period cottages to modern apartments. The village is also home to several community facilities, including a library, post office, and community center.

Overall, Harefield provides a tranquil and convenient location for those looking to move for work in the London area. With its rich history, beautiful surroundings, and excellent job opportunities, it's no wonder that many people choose to call this charming village home.
